为什么呢? 我明明在php.ini中把设置 session.save_path=/tmp然后在in c:\fox\www\  (就是我的网站根目录)下建立了一个tmp目录,这样为什么不行呢?

解决方案 »

  1.   

    你可以动态的设置session的保存路径不过每次用session是都要设置有点麻烦
    session_save_path("./tmp"); //<---设置session的保存路径为当前目录的tmp文件夹下
    session_start();
    echo(session_id());
      

  2.   

    我有类似的问题,不会报错,只是session_start();
    echo($abs);后 $abs是空的   我注册了这个变量,也赋值了
    regist_gloabes=on有人知道吗?
     
      

  3.   

    把php.ini中的
    session.save_path=
    指向一个实际存在的目标呀,比如,在C盘根目录下建一个temp目录,那么就可以写成
    session.save_path=c:\temp
    就可以了。
      

  4.   

    我建了这样的目录
    我的是 c:\php4\temp
    目录也存在
    而且  include path=c:\php4\temp
    还是不行啊